After winning the T20 World Cup 2024, there is a huge update on the return of the Indian team that was trapped in Barbados due to Hurricane Storm. The team's return to India timetable has once again changed. The BCCI has scheduled a special jet to convey the squad back to India from Barbados. This flight will also transport approximately 22 Indian sports journalists, although the departure time will be delayed due to the hurricane. This flight is now expected to arrive in New Delhi at about 6 a.m. on Thursday (Indian time).

According to the information, the special flight of the Indian team will land in New Delhi at 6 am on Thursday. In fact, the T20 World Cup winning team, along with its support staff, several BCCI officials, and the families of the players, is stuck in Barbados due to Hurricane Beryl. The team was earlier scheduled to leave Barbados at 11 am (IST) local time on Monday, but it was delayed due to the storm.

The Indian team's special flight is expected to reach Delhi directly from Bridgetown. After reaching here, the team will be given a grand welcome and a roadshow will also be organized. Not only this, the players will also be honored by Prime Minister Narendra Modi. However, there is no confirmation of the program yet.
